Transaction 0266cd63e6359f9f587e7520dd03a590fa2fbf8b97245f576afcb87e307befc9
1 Input
1 Output
-
0266cd63e6359f9f587e7520dd03a590fa2fbf8b97245f576afcb87e307befc9:0
- value
- 622648
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8b544f6fc4f024b6f4c5c798f157b4309e2b5204 OP_EQUAL
- address
- 3EPirBzzR9EePZp2RfarnbbKn1ZM7TUHPy